Beginner basics
Where to go
The horseshoe bay protects the inside from the worst of the swell — start near the south corner of the main beach where the bay shelters you. The reform is a manageable learning wave on small days.
What to avoid
Don't paddle to the outside reefs (the right-hand point on the north side) until you have real experience — they're rocky and the current pushes you out of the bay. Cold water in winter (June–August).
Best beginner conditions
Knee-to-waist S or SE swell, 10s+ period, light N or NW wind, mid tide. Late spring and autumn are the friendliest seasons.
